What is timber logging?

A Timber Logging job involves harvesting trees for wood and transporting them to sawmills or processing facilities. Loggers use specialized equipment like chainsaws, feller bunchers, and skidders to cut and move timber safely and efficiently. The job requires physical strength, knowledge of forestry practices, and adherence to environmental and safety regulations. Loggers often work in remote forested areas under various weather conditions.

What are the typical work conditions and environment like for timber logging professionals?

Timber loggers typically work outdoors in forests and woodlands, often in varying weather conditions and sometimes on uneven or rugged terrain. The work involves physical labor, operating heavy equipment, and adhering to strict safety procedures to manage risks associated with falling trees and machinery. Teams often coordinate closely to ensure efficient workflow and safety, communicating regularly throughout each shift. While the role can be physically demanding, it also provides opportunities for advancement into supervisory or equipment specialist positions with experience and additional training.

Log Truck Driver - Longview

Weyerhaeuser's Washington trucking operation is seeking experienced professional Log Truck Drivers at our Longview, WA location. Weyerhaeuser is a premier timber and wood products company with over 125 years in the industry. Our roots run deep in the PNW with tree farms and manufacturing strategically located to provide sustainable products to our customers for years to come. We offer a predictable driver work schedule, Monday thru Friday, day shift hours with optional overtime. Our trucks are serviced by company mechanics to ensure they are ready to run every day. Drivers are expected to operate long and short haul trucks. The pay rate for this position is $31.550 per hour and includes a comprehensive benefits package: medical, dental, vision, paid sick time, retirement, vacation, holiday pay and relocation assistance is available to those who qualify. Hourly employees are represented by the IAM-AW union.

Qualifications:

  • Verifiable high school diploma or equivalent
  • Valid CDL with safe driving record on public highways and/or logging roads
  • Current DOT medical card
  • Two years of verifiable experience operating a log truck
  • Two years free of driving incident citations
  • Be safety-conscious and adhere to all the safety procedures and practices
  • Successful completion of a post-offer physical exam, drug screen and background check are required

This position is designated by WY as a safety-sensitive position. Please be advised that due to the designation of this position as safety-sensitive, you will be subject to pre-employment testing for cannabis and its metabolites.

Weyerhaeuser is a leading international forest products company based in Seattle, WA, US. Established in 1900, the company has grown to become one of the largest timberland owners in the world. Weyerhaeuser is deeply rooted in the forestry industry and excels in timberland management, as well as the manufacture and distribution of a diverse range of forest products. The product slate encompasses lumber, plywood, wood chips, and other wood-derived materials predominantly used in construction, cellulose fiber production, and bioenergy.
